Top 10 Health Trends You Should Be Focusing on in 2025

Date:

As we move deeper into 2025, the health and wellness landscape continues to evolve rapidly. From breakthroughs in technology to shifts in how we approach mental and physical well-being, here are the top 10 health trends you should keep on your radar this year.

1. Gut Health Takes Center Stage

Scientific research continues to uncover how gut health affects everything from immunity to mood. Probiotics, prebiotics, and personalized gut-friendly diets are booming as people seek to optimize their microbiomes.

2. Mental Wellness Becomes Mainstream

Therapy, meditation, and digital mental health tools are no longer niche but essential parts of self-care. The stigma around seeking help continues to break down, especially among younger generations.

3. Intermittent Fasting and Time-Restricted Eating

These eating patterns gain popularity for their potential benefits in weight management, metabolic health, and longevity, with more personalized approaches emerging.

4. AI-Powered Health Solutions

Artificial intelligence is revolutionizing diagnostics, personalized treatment plans, and health monitoring apps, making healthcare more accessible and efficient.

5. Sustainable and Plant-Based Nutrition

Consumers are more aware of how their food choices impact the planet and their health, fueling the rise of plant-based diets and sustainable sourcing.

6. Digital Detox and Mindful Tech Use

With growing concerns about screen time and digital overload, many are adopting “digital detox” routines to improve sleep, focus, and mental clarity.

7. Fitness Gets Functional and Holistic

Functional fitness that supports everyday movement and holistic approaches integrating mind-body-spirit practices are reshaping workout trends.

8. Personalized Nutrition and Genomics

Advances in genomics allow for diets tailored to individual genetic profiles, optimizing nutrient intake and health outcomes.

9. Immune Health Optimization

Post-pandemic awareness has made immune health a priority, with supplements, lifestyle habits, and nutrition focused on strengthening the body’s defenses.

10. Sleep as a Health Priority

Recognizing sleep’s crucial role in overall health, innovations in sleep tracking and therapy for sleep disorders are gaining traction.
